Intel Appoints Bob Swan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er
September 19 2016 - 04:01PM
Business Wire
Intel Corporation today announced the appointment of Robert
“Bob” H. Swan as executive vice president and chief financial
officer (CFO), effective Oct. 10, 2016. Swan will report to Intel
CEO Brian Krzanich and oversee Intel’s global finance and IT
organizations, as well as the Corporate Strategy Office. He
replaces Stacy Smith, who, as previously announced, is taking a
broader role within Intel leading manufacturing, sales and
operations. Smith served nine years as Intel’s CFO.

Swan, 56, joins Intel from growth equity firm General Atlantic
where he served as an operating partner working closely with the
firm's global portfolio companies on growth objectives. Prior to
General Atlantic, he served nine years as the CFO of eBay Inc.
Before that, he was CFO at Electronic Data Systems Corp and at TRW
Inc. He also served as CFO, COO and CEO of Webvan Group Inc. Prior
to that, Bob served in a number of senior finance roles at General
Electric.
